Diving into the Quantum World: An Introduction

The quantum world is a realm of mysterious phenomena that challenges our everyday intuition. At its core, quantum mechanics illuminates the behavior of matter and energy at the atomic and subatomic levels. Unlike the classical world, where objects have definite properties, quantum entities exist in a state of superposition, meaning they can be in multiple states simultaneously until detected. This intriguing concept has led to many groundbreaking discoveries and technological advancements, such as lasers, transistors, and subatomic computers.
